The Pittsburgh Creators' Project is a non-profit organization to build bridges between the creators of Pittsburgh: composers, choreographers, photographers, filmmakers, chefs, artists, writers, and others who are creating locally or have ties to the Greater Pittsburgh Area. The ultimate goal is to provide opportunities which bring a sense of community and collaboration to all creators in the greater Pittsburgh area communities.

The specific objectives and purpose of this organization shall be:
- To promote the collective creative artistic endeavors of our region;
- To provide a forum for which all creators can interact;
- To sponsor, host and participate in events and activities that promote the arts;
- To provide instruction in the arts;
- To hold conferences, symposia, and other meetings; publish journals, music, books, and other publications; seek and accept grants, gifts, and contracts for any of its purposes;
- To provide opportunities for participants to engage in visual and performing arts.
